Want a piece of ABC gum? Head to this fascinating, if somewhat unsanitary, walkway that features walls covered with gum of the "already been chewed" variety.

Find it on Higuera St, between Garden and Broad, next to Blast 825 Tap room.
It's a fun thing to seek out and take photos of, you know pretending to put your tongue or your hand up against it. Don't forget to put your own glob of gum on the wall! It's somewhat unique, but other than that, there's not much to it.
We parked at the City of San Luis Obispo Parking lot and walked.
